| """Cross-cell results aggregator for the trainable-KV length ablation. |
| |
| Run AFTER the 10 cells (5 lengths × 2 datasets) finish. Walks every |
| data/eval/kvlen/<DS>/p<P>/preds.jsonl, recomputes metrics from the per-record |
| source of truth (so it's robust to a cell that was interrupted mid-judge), and |
| renders side-by-side comparison tables that no single per-cell stats.json gives: |
| |
| 1. Per-dataset summary: rows = KV length p, cols = n / coverage / judge_acc / |
| judge_correct_rate / em / f1 |
| 2. Per-dataset judge_acc broken out BY query_type × KV length (which question |
| types benefit from a longer cartridge?) |
| |
| Pure stdlib — NO torch / NO cartridges import — so it runs on any machine |
| (including CPU-only), unlike eval_direct_ask.py. |
| |
| Usage: |
| python scripts/train/analyze_kvlen.py # both datasets, default lengths |
| python scripts/train/analyze_kvlen.py --datasets lmes # one dataset |
| python scripts/train/analyze_kvlen.py --csv data/eval/kvlen/summary.csv |
| """ |
